80 MHz Cortex-M4F with FPU — real-time control headroom

The Texas Instruments TM4C1230E6PMT7R is a Tiva™ C series 32-bit ARM® Cortex®-M4F microcontroller running at 80 MHz. The single-cycle multiply-and-accumulate and single-precision floating-point unit give this part the arithmetic headroom for closed-loop motor current loops or sensor fusion without a separate DSP. 128 KB of Flash and 32K x 8 of SRAM are sized for a single control algorithm with modest data logging; the 2K x 8 EEPROM holds calibration constants or boot parameters without wearing the Flash. The 49 general-purpose I/O lines, plus CAN, I²C, SPI, SSI, and UART interfaces, cover the typical industrial communication stack — CANopen for drive networks, SPI for external ADCs or encoders, and UART for Modbus RTU drops. The internal oscillator and brown-out detect/POR/WDT peripherals reduce external BOM count for a compact controller board.

Supply range of 1.08 V to 3.63 V.
